Golf Course Estate Sarasota National

A Golf Course Estate Sarasota National delivers a layered amenity package that goes well beyond the fairways themselves, beginning with a Gordon Lewis–designed 18-hole championship course that incorporates natural wetlands and protected preserve buffers as design features rather than obstacles. The course layout demands strategy at every elevation change, making it equally appealing to competitive golfers and casual weekend players who simply want a visually compelling round in a well-maintained setting.
Sarasota National’s clubhouse campus spans 19,000 square feet and functions as a genuine social and recreational hub for estate residents. The facility includes a resort-style zero-entry pool with a dedicated lap lane, a fully equipped fitness center, tennis courts, pickleball courts, a spa treatment suite, and a dining venue — all maintained under the community’s structured HOA. Interior finishes in a typical Golf Course Estate Sarasota National reflect the construction era of the mid-2010s through early 2020s, with open-concept floor plans, volume ceilings reaching 10 to 12 feet, impact-rated windows and doors, and upgraded tile or engineered hardwood throughout primary living areas. Chef-caliber kitchens are standard in the estate tier, featuring quartz or granite countertops, stainless steel appliances, and large kitchen islands designed for both function and entertaining. Outdoor living spaces in these estates are purpose-built for Southwest Florida’s subtropical climate: screened-in lanais, covered loggias, and private pool decks are standard estate features, with many lots oriented to capture prevailing Gulf breezes while overlooking golf course fairways or wetland preserves.
Southwest Florida’s building codes have been progressively strengthened after successive hurricane seasons, and homes constructed within Sarasota National during its primary build-out years benefit from concrete block construction, elevated slab foundations, and impact-rated glazing that meet or exceed current Sarasota County wind-load requirements. A Golf Course Estate Sarasota National therefore represents a category of residence that is both lifestyle-driven and structurally prepared for the region’s climate realities — two factors that discerning buyers increasingly weigh together. The Audubon Silver Signature Sanctuary designation protecting the community’s preserve corridors also means that surrounding natural buffers are maintained under a formal environmental program, which limits future development density and reinforces the long-term character of the neighborhood.

Golf Course Property Sarasota National

Golf Course Property Sarasota National appeals strongly to buyers interested in customizing a resale estate or completing a new-construction build within an established, deed-restricted golf community in Sarasota County. While the community’s primary build-out is largely complete, a segment of resale inventory exists where buyers can negotiate updated finishes, additional pool features, or lanai expansions through licensed Sarasota County contractors without disrupting the broader neighborhood’s architectural continuity. The deed-restriction framework maintained by the Sarasota National HOA establishes consistent design standards — from roofline profiles to approved exterior paint palettes — that preserve community aesthetics while still allowing meaningful interior and outdoor customization.
Working with qualified local builders and designers familiar with Sarasota County’s permitting office is especially important when making modifications to a Golf Course Property Sarasota National resale home. Sarasota County requires permits for structural additions, pool installations, and significant exterior alterations, and the HOA’s Architectural Review Committee must also approve changes before work begins. Buyers should factor a realistic permitting timeline — typically four to eight weeks for standard residential projects in Sarasota County — into any renovation or upgrade plan. Engaging a buyer’s agent with direct experience in Sarasota National transactions simplifies both the HOA intake process and the county permitting sequence, reducing the risk of delays that can push a planned move-in date back by several months. Estate-tier homes in this community were built predominantly by DiVosta Homes, a builder with a regional track record in Southwest Florida, which means structural documentation and original permit records are generally accessible through the county’s public records system.
From a practical standpoint, Golf Course Property Sarasota National positions buyers within 6 miles of Venice’s historic downtown district, 20 miles south of Sarasota’s cultural corridor on US-41, and within a 90-minute drive of both Tampa International Airport and Fort Myers’ Southwest Florida International Airport. Sarasota Memorial Hospital maintains a Venice campus approximately 4 miles from the community, and Sarasota County’s school district — consistently rated among Florida’s top-performing — serves families with children at all grade levels. These logistical anchors make Sarasota National a coherent long-term choice for buyers prioritizing both lifestyle and infrastructure without sacrificing the refined, golf-focused community character that defines the address.
